Marie Skłodowska-Curie Doctoral Fellow in Smart Ports Systems Integration

📍 Location: Gothenburg, Sweden (Chalmers University of Technology)
📅 Application Deadline: August 31, 2025 (23:59 CET)
🔗 Chalmers University of Technology

About the Position

This fully funded doctoral position at Chalmers University of Technology is part of the Marie Skłodowska-Curie Doctoral Network Ports as Energy Transition Hubs (POTENT), funded under Horizon Europe. The research focuses on advancing the modeling, simulation, and integration of complex energy-digital systems for smart ports. You will engage in interdisciplinary research and industry secondments (DTU Compute and Danfoss Power Electronics), contributing to Europe’s clean energy transition.

Research Focus

  • Develop multi-layer modeling architectures using AADL and Modelica/FMI

  • Design resilience metrics and assessment methods for cyber-physical energy systems

  • Conduct system simulations and collaborate with academic and industrial partners

  • Disseminate research results via open science platforms

Requirements

  • Master’s degree in Systems Engineering, Control, Optimization, or related fields

  • Strong background in modeling and simulation of complex systems

  • Proficiency with digital tools, simulation environments, and academic writing

  • Fluent English communication skills

  • Compliance with MSCA mobility rule (not residing in Sweden >12 months in last 36 months)

Merit:

  • Computer Science background

  • Knowledge of energy systems, co-simulation, resilience analysis

  • Experience working with industry or interdisciplinary teams
